
TAMBUNAN: The wife of Deputy Chief Minister I, Datin Seri Cecelia Edwin Kitingan suggested that the collaboration between institutions and the Sabah Economic Development and Investment Authority should continue in further empowering women as the main driving force of the family and national development.
She said cooperation could create collaboration between two organisations to strengthen relations, increase consensus and the bonds of friendship between the community and people of the institution concerned.
“Women’s empowerment is the basis for bridging the gender gap where the role of women is very significant in life,” she said when closing the Community College Open Day in conjunction with the Sedia Outreach Programme with the College here.
